Sunday, 11 November 2012

Finding the Sasquatch

There’s two kinds of people in this world: Those who believe Bigfoot is real, and those who don’t. Idaho State University anthropologist Jeffrey Meldrum is firmly in the I Believe camp and he is taking to the skies, via blimp, in one of the most elaborate hunts yet to prove the doubters wrong.

